Transaction e06ddc7334c5f5790e7d6fd1ec2b65c3a16632fbe9fee069185978ca7a978156
1 Input
1 Output
-
e06ddc7334c5f5790e7d6fd1ec2b65c3a16632fbe9fee069185978ca7a978156:0
- value
- 16663284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fe50505c56bee32a7cbc69593d66499eb59b1e2 OP_EQUAL
- address
- 3KBfLkC3gcxmYBZiQQ6kcjtTDvQ1JgWD1E